This movie has its flaws and struggles with believable and realistic dialogues, however, having a strong female character who is not afraid of war and violence is certainly a plus. The landscapes, camera shots, cinematography are splendid and worth to see. Ben Kinglsey and Haluk Bilginer are always great - they are mastering in acting. I especially liked the acting of Michiel Huisman who showed a side of heroism, compassion and complexity of morals.
